Along the way, [[Goombrat]]s will try to stop them by charging at them. Each time a character is hit by a Goombrat, they lose an acorn. Players can also collide into one another in an attempt to knock them into a Goombrat. If a player loses all five acorns, they will be considered out of the competition. At the end of the minigame, the player with the most remaining acorns wins. | ||
